How Did Mark Drakeford Lose His Temper at Andrew RT Davies? A Closer Look

Recently, a heated exchange between Andrew RT Davies and Mark Drakeford sparked considerable interest and controversy. According to Vaughan Gethings, a cabinet member Mick Antoniw revealed, the incident was a clear indication of the tensions surrounding the state of the National Health Service (NHS) and the effects of budget cuts.

A Matter of NHS Budget and Performance

During Davies' comment about a constituent waiting for an ambulance with a back injury, Mark Drakeford's response was both candid and direct. He stated, 'It is the Tories who set the budget, and you have the cheek to ask me why it is bad and how bad it is! ' This response encapsulates the frustration many in the Labour party feel towards their Conservative counterparts and their impact on public services.
